Francisco Lindor, Carlos Carrasco traded to Mets

An era in Cleveland is over while a new one begins in New York

The deal is official via the team’s Twitter account. Francisco Lindor and Carlos Carrasco are members of the Mets, while four are returned to Cleveland: infielders Andrés Giménez and Amed Rosario, and prospects Isiah Greene and Josh Wolf.

According to Jeff Passan, Cleveland was in deep talks with the Mets for a Francisco Lindor deal around 12:30 p.m. ET, and by 1 p.m. the deal was official. The two sides were reportedly finalizing the steps, which typically means exchanging physicals.
